On 01/20/2014 08:26 PM, Johannes Lorenz wrote: > Hi, > > if there would be ZynAddSubFX in Qt, there would be two variants: > 1. Put the UI into the MainWindow (this was not possible with FLTK). The UI > will be large (Probably one large MDI window), so it might make sense to > maximize it inside LMMS, like you can do it with the piano roll. > 2. Open a new window for the synth. > > What would you prefer? What is more handy? > > The question is interesting because internal windows would imply using > threads for the different ZynAddSubFX instruments. External windows would > also allow processes. >
#1 definitely, whenever I use Zyn currently the windows are constantly losing focus and hiding behind the LMMS window, unless I pin them up in which case they're constantly in the way... so I usually have to resort to putting them on another workspace, which doesn't work all that well either. Having them inside the LMMS main window would be best IMO. ------------------------------------------------------------------------------ CenturyLink Cloud: The Leader in Enterprise Cloud Services.
